About The Position

The Loan Servicing Associate supports the largest and most sophisticated corporate loan transactions in the market.  They primarily provide operational support to Debt Capital Markets on Term Loan B/institutional debt where JPM is the administrative agent. This position is responsible for providing loan servicing/administrative support (reconciliation/billing/payments) and has direct communication with borrowers, lenders and business partners.

Responsibilities

  • Initiate loan activity (fundings, repricings, payments) as instructed by the client in accordance with credit agreements
  • Calculation and tracking of complex interest and fee accruals at various rate levels across changing lender distributions
  • Reconcile daily funding and payment activity to account for all daily cash transactions
  • Read and interpret complex legal credit agreements and related documentation working with attorneys when applicable
  • Initiate and reconcile automated funds movement in accordance with client/lender instructions
  • Monitor and escalate past due principal, interest, and fees to ensure that the loan accounting system is accurate and provide clients timely and accurate invoices
  • Maintenance of margin changes and proper communication to bank group
  • Provide information as requested by Clients, Business Partners, Middle Office, or Lenders
  • Monitor control reports updating applicable comments
  • Assist with any administrative tasks associated with the terms of a Credit Agreement
  • Perform quality control  on new deals, restructures and amendments by thoroughly understanding the credit agreement verifying system set up accuracy
